PokerStars is kicking off an eight-week-long promotion called the Summer Games that pits Canadians vs. Americans in a fight to snag some of the more than 80,000 cash prizes to be given away and seats in the $100,000 final, and it all starts this Friday, Aug. 22.
Each week features a different poker variation, and players get one free round-one entry for each week’s poker variant. Each country has a separate set of tournaments, and the free entry can be used for any of the round-one Summer Games tournaments running during that week for the player’s home country.
Those who finish well enough in the round-one event move on to that week’s round-two final, and the weekly finals send five players from each country to the $100,000 main event. Then, the next week, players can try their hands at a different poker variation with another free round-one entry.
The round-one and round-two events aren’t just qualifiers, though; plenty of cash prizes are being awarded in each tournament.
Here’s the schedule of events:
| Event | Game | Qualification Period | Final (ET) |
| 1 | Limit hold’em | Aug. 22-28 | Aug. 31, 4 p.m. |
| 2 | Seven-card stud | Aug. 29-Sept. 4 | Sept. 7, 4 p.m. |
| 3 | Five-card draw | Sept. 5-11 | Sept. 14, 4 p.m. |
| 4 | Omaha | Sept. 12-18 | Sept. 21, 4 p.m. |
| 5 | Short-handed no-limit hold’em | Sept. 19-25 | Sept. 28, 4 p.m. |
| 6 | Pot-limit hold’em | Sept. 26-Oct. 2 | Oct. 5, 4 p.m. |
| 7 | Omaha eight-or-better | Oct. 3-10 | Oct. 12, 4 p.m. |
| 8 | No-limit hold’em | Oct. 11-16 | Oct. 19, 4 p.m. |
